Yes, several companies are making them with various tweaks. Probably to get around original patent????? We also use ours on dirt turnrows, field roads and just about anywhere you get the surface messed up. They don’t like grass(especially the factory models, too little clearance) nor will they do much anything in just one pass. However, they also don’t normally screw up a road, even with an inexperienced operator. I’ve used them to put a really slick finish on yards before sodding.

FYI, you can control depth with top link. A hydraulic top link is even better!
